New communication technology experiment satellite launched in Xichang
A new communication technology experiment satellite is launched at 11:36 p.m. (Beijing Time) by a Long March-3B carrier rocket at the Xichang Satellite Launch Center in Xichang, southwest China's Sichuan Province, Feb. 4, 2021. The satellite will be used in communication, radio, television and data transmission, as well as technology tests. This launch marked the 360th mission for the Long March series carrier rockets.
